Я работал над приложением Azure и добавил в службу WCF (что я успешно делал раньше).
Он отлично работает в автономном приложении asp.net (запущенном в Cassini), но выдает ошибку 500.0, когда я пытаюсь вызвать его в AppFabric. Я пытался опубликовать его в Azure и надеяться на лучшее, но затем выдает ошибку 404.
Я установил привязки к basicHttpBinding, без радости. Чтобы обойти это, я создал отдельную веб-роль WCF, которая работает нормально, но на некоторых машинах возникают проблемы с брандмауэром, поскольку он работает на порте 8080.
Я предполагаю, что это как-то связано с web.config - я видел ссылку, что добавление <validation validateIntegratedModeConfiguration="false"/>
к <system.webServer>
может исправить это, но это уже было.
«Подробная информация об ошибке» на странице:
Модуль IsapiModule
Уведомление ExecuteRequestHandler
Обработчик svcHandler
Код ошибки 0x800700c1
Есть идеи? Я сбит с толку!
ура
Toby